Description

Believed to have been built in around 1860 as a terrace of four fisherman's cottages and then converted into two cottages in the 1930s. Converted into a single dwelling in the early 1960s and completely renovated in 1995. Strand View Park is a private road that also provides access to the Bay Apartments and the former Glendun and Cushendun hotels. House is on the quayside close to Cushendun Bridge and the harbour and overlooks the River Dun where it flows into Cushendun Bay. The windows in the living room provide views of the Torr Road, Tornamona Point, the Mull of Kintyre and the Ayreshire coast, and Sanda Island. Windows that look out on the garden provide views of Glendun and Cushleake Mountain.   • Garden is approximately 0.25 of an acre. This was originally a working garden, with the top garden used for growing fruit and the bottom garden used to cultivate vegetables. Garden is sheltered by the house from any breeze off the sea. It also has sunshine from early morning, with the front of the house a suntrap during the afternoon and evening. There is a right of way around the perimeter of the garden that provides pedestrian access to Cave Road
